Lomelda is the stage name of musician Hannah Read. According to Read, Lomelda is a made-up word that means "echo of the stars".

Her next album, ''M for Empathy'', was released on March 1, 2019. Despite having 11 songs, the album clocks a total of 16 minutes. ''M for Empathy'' marked Read’s emerging use of piano to add to her customary guitar-oriented songs, as the primary instrument for the song “Bunk” and prominent in other songs including “M for Magic” and “M for Mush”.
